BDO Canada has partnered with fintech platform Intuit to deliver an integrated service for small and mid-sized businesses in the country.

The new integrated service, BDO Powered by Intuit QuickBooks, will provide business owners with actionable financial insights and help in decision making.

It is aimed at reducing the time owners spend on routine, manual administrative work and increasing the use of financial data in day-to-day and longer-term planning.

Intuit QuickBooks Canada/LATAM sales director Gary Drysdale said: “This collaboration with BDO Canada truly embodies the spirit of our mission at Intuit, to power prosperity for consumers and businesses around the world.

“By combining the technology, insights and unparalleled data of QuickBooks with BDO’s deep financial acumen and advisory expertise, we are providing a transformative experience for Canadian businesses.

“This collaboration will give them the foresight and capabilities to navigate their business finances with confidence, and we look forward to seeing how this collaboration will help Canadian businesses thrive.”

For advisors, the service is intended to shift effort away from repetitive tasks and towards work such as analysis, financial management, problem-solving and strategic guidance.

The service brings together the competence of BDO’s national advisory team and new features in QuickBooks Online Accountant.

According to a BDO Canada statement, BDO Powered by Intuit QuickBooks will enable direct advice from BDO professionals and real-time visibility of financial data and performance measures shared between businesses and their advisors.

It also includes AI-led automation intended to reduce friction in everyday accounting work, alongside a model to support business growth.

The partnership also introduces benchmarking tools for comparing results with peers.

BDO Canada Corporate Growth & Operational Excellence partner and leader Jim Krahn said: “This partnership is about making it easier for Canadian businesses to succeed.

“By bringing together BDO’s trusted advisory capabilities with Intuit’s AI-powered platform, we are giving our clients a smarter, more seamless experience – one that simplifies complex decisions, delivers real-time insights and helps them move forward with confidence.”
